This is a knock-off of one of my old love-to-hate decks: UWg Limited Resources, I would pick up when ever our playgroup would get too far into ponderous lock-decks. The original deck was a bit more old-school than the Ward-version above, and had some problems with cheap beatdown, especially fliers like Serendib Efreet and friends. The difference betwen having maximum of 10 land ever in play or having equal amounts cause a bit of tension, so I included also the Limited Resources for good times. Also all your creatures are able to self-sacrifice so they can be played early and even act as fodder for the Tinker for Ward.

One thing to remember is that with Plainswalker out any opponent can attack your 'Walker even with Prison/Propaganda out, as they only prevent creatures attacking you. If you have some Moats and Humilitys, just replace the Prisons/Propagandas with them to have even better lock. (And change the Tezz into another Elspeth, as Humility/Moat and Tezzeret are not an combo. [Humility will be applied only after Tezzeret making all your artifacts creatures and make them 1/1 and Moat stops them cold even as 5/5's.])

This deck's goal is to disrupt the opponent early with Thoughtseize / Sculler, and then lock them out of creature win-cons with Wrath's and Ward of Bones. Ward also has nice synergy with Scourglass. Once locked, the player can build Ajani counters to his ultimate, lay down a single Oona, or simply beat face with Mutavault tokens and laugh unless they have Flash creatures (which you can promptly remove).

The sideboard should be fairly self explanatory. The needles hose the Planeswalker deck, Halo and Story Circle are generic answers to many troublesome decks, the wheel deals with Reveillark and Sanity Grinding, and the Stillmoon can come in on creature light decks or beat back Bitterblossom tokens.

Okay now i go over the ideas for this deck.

Its basicly an esper control deck using all the cards you expect pretty mutch. But it also has an artiact theme to go with Tezzeret, which is an isnane powerful engine and also fine against control decks. It also serve to roll of an finisher.

I go now over some 1 ofs.
The Random Millstone is against slow decks so you can kill them, because its kind of hard to kill an control deck with tezzeret. Dont forget to untap millstone with tezzeret.
The Bottle Gnomes is basicly for some lifegain and a bit blocking, it often gives you quite some life, because they kill gnomes (about a 6 life swing) and will also kill Tezzeret(if you got it with him) which is some more life.
Pithing needle is just an awesome card in this metagame against a lot of decks, you can name manlands, planeswalker, figure of destiny....
The Capsules are overall good cards, i think they are self explaining, but still. Blue is a fine card to search up if you running out of gas, Black is for creature control and the white one is basicly for bitterblossom.

Now what Does Ward of Bones do in this deck. You may have noticed i dont play any creatures but bottlegnomes, which can be sacrificed to itselff. So you can stall out creature decks, by having runed halo or story circle in play and Ward of bones, so each creature in their deck turns into a dead card. That may not seem as mutch but a lot of control decks also depend on creatures like mulldrifter..., if they play an early kithcen finks and you get a way to stop them, all those cards also turn death, not to mention each spot removal they may play. Its also important to note that stop playing lands against some control decks may be worth considering.

Some matchups now, you can pretty mutch win against any aggresive deck, the more burn they got the harder it gets, but not unsolvable. I usualy win against agressive decks.

Decks like Mana Ramp, are pretty mutch in my favor depending on the build.

The Control matchup isnt as bad either, because you play a lot of answers, and an early ward of bones or Tezzeret can easily win you the game. I am not sure how the % are but its not bad, espacally if they try to go beatdown with finks and you stick a ward of bones. I also guess that alot of the time the players arent sure how to play against it so i may overestimating this matchup

Now the bad matchup, its defenatly faeries, its kind of hard to win against them, although belive it or not ward of bones isnt as bad against faeries either, if it sticks, a lot of stuff becomes uterly useless. Its still a bad matchup.

I didnt play against any other deck, but i think merfolk shouldnt be great as well, its still a fun deck and has a decent powerlevel.
